A funeral service will be held at 3pm Saturday, March 16 at Faith Church of Midway, by the Rev. Michael Gates.

Burial will follow at Beulah United Church of Christ Cemetery. The family will receive friends from 1-3pm Saturday at the church prior to the funeral service. Mr. Shoaf was born December 22, 1935 in Davidson County to Norman Olin Shoaf and Edith Walser Shoaf.

Mack had a life full of service to his community, including board positions with Jaycees and Davidson County Board of Adjustments to name a few. He took great pride in serving on the Board of Directors of EnergyUnited for over 40 years. Though Mack’s life was filled with accomplishments, what he valued most was simply his family and farming.

He is survived by his wife of 60 years, Peggy Hanes Shoaf; his son, Mack Todd Shoaf and wife, Rosa, of Midway; his daughter, Elizabeth (Sissy) Shoaf White and husband, Lindley also of Midway; and his grandchildren, Dania Sofia Shoaf and Loucas Todd Shoaf.
